Choosing the wrong spool for your FDM machine turns a weekend project into a stringy, warped mess. PLA is great for desk toys, but real functional parts demand materials that handle heat, impact, and repeated flexing without cracking. Whether you are printing a drone arm, a custom phone case, or a heat-resistant bracket for your garage, the filament you load determines whether your part survives or shatters on first use.
I’m Mo Maruf — the founder and writer behind The Tools Trunk. After analyzing hundreds of customer reports, reviewing manufacturer QC sheets, and cross-referencing real-world print logs, I’ve identified the specific ABS and TPU formulations that deliver reliable layer adhesion, tight diameter tolerances, and consistent extrusion for demanding prints.
This guide breaks down the top spools for strength and flexibility, helping you match the right material to your project without wasting time or material on bad rolls. 3d printer filament choices come down to knowing what your printer can handle and what your part needs to endure.
How To Choose The Best 3D Printer Filament
Most beginners buy the cheapest spool they find and wonder why their part delaminates or snaps. The truth is, filament quality shows up in three metrics: diameter consistency, melt-flow stability, and moisture management. For functional parts, you also need to pick a polymer that matches your part’s physical demands — ABS for heat resistance and rigidity, TPU for impact absorption and flexibility.
Material Type: Rigid vs. Flexible
ABS (acrylonitrile butadiene styrene) is a stiff thermoplastic that maintains structural integrity up to roughly 90°C before softening. It is the go-to choice for enclosures, tool housings, and brackets that sit near a hot motor or in a car interior. TPU (thermoplastic polyurethane) is an elastomer with a Shore A hardness typically around 95A — it stretches, compresses, and returns to shape. Use TPU for vibration dampeners, gaskets, phone cases, and any part that needs to bend repeatedly without cracking.
Diameter Tolerance and Extrusion Consistency
A spool rated to +/- 0.02 mm will feed through your hotend with fewer pressure fluctuations than one rated to +/- 0.05 mm. Tight tolerance reduces the chance of partial clogs and ensures that your extrusion multiplier stays predictable roll after roll. Cheaper spools often have sections that measure 1.70 mm or 1.80 mm, causing under-extrusion and over-extrusion in the same print. Stick to brands that publish their CCD measurement systems.
Printing Environment Requirements
ABS demands an enclosed printer with a chamber temperature above 40°C to prevent drafts from causing edge-lift and layer separation. Some modern ABS blends, such as ABS Pro, reduce warp and lower the odor compared to classic ABS. TPU prints well on open-frame machines, but it absorbs moisture from the air aggressively — a dry box or active drying before use is essential for consistent results. The same spool that printed beautifully on Monday can string and bubble by Wednesday if left out.
Quick Comparison
On smaller screens, swipe sideways to see the full table.
| Model | Category | Best For | Key Spec | Amazon |
|---|---|---|---|---|
| FLASHFORGE ABS Pro | ABS | Heat-resistant functional parts | Diameter +/- 0.02 mm | Amazon |
| Polymaker PolyFlex TPU95 | TPU | High-quality flexible prints, tires | Shore 95A, 400% strain | Amazon |
| Creality CR-ABS 2kg Bundle | ABS | Large builds, engineering prototypes | Impact-resistant, 2kg bundle | Amazon |
| ANYCUBIC TPU 95A | TPU | Beginner-friendly flexible parts | Shore 95A, 1kg spool | Amazon |
| JAYO TPU 4-Color Bundle | TPU | Multi-color small projects | 4x 250g spools, Shore 95A | Amazon |
In‑Depth Reviews
1. FLASHFORGE ABS Pro Filament 1.75mm Black
The ABS Pro formulation addresses the two biggest complaints about standard ABS: aggressive warp and strong fumes. Real-world prints from users confirm that at 230°C nozzle and 90°C bed temperatures, this spool produces crisp details with minimal edge lift even on large parts like ROG Ally grips. The reduced shrinkage means you can print taller models without the corners peeling up mid-print.
Diameter consistency holds tight at +/- 0.02 mm thanks to Flashforge’s CCD adaptive control system. This directly translates to stable extrusion across the entire 1 kg spool — no random thin sections that cause under-extrusion. A handful of reviews note that the material is slightly more brittle than classic ABS when snapped by hand, but layer adhesion in printed parts is excellent, and functional items like tool housings survive real abuse.
The low-odor claim checks out: while you still want ventilation for any ABS print, the chemical smell is noticeably less aggressive than budget ABS rolls. Bed adhesion is strong without glue stick, and bridging performance is good enough for gaps up to 50 mm. If you need a rigid, heat-resistant filament that prints predictably out of the bag, this is the spool to load.
What works
- Tight +/– 0.02 mm diameter tolerance for consistent extrusion
- Low warp and low odor compared to standard ABS
- Prints well at standard temperatures without pre-drying
What doesn’t
- Material feels slightly more brittle than classic ABS when cold
- Layer adhesion weaker than PETG for impact-heavy parts
2. Polymaker PolyFlex TPU95 1.75mm Black 0.75kg
Polymaker’s PolyFlex TPU95 is widely regarded as the benchmark for flexible desktop printing. The Shore 95A durometer hits a sweet spot — flexible enough to print gaskets, tire treads, and vibration mounts, yet stiff enough to hold its shape under load without collapsing. Users consistently report outstanding layer adhesion, with prints at 100% infill appearing nearly monolithic with no visible layer lines.
The spool ships vacuum-sealed with desiccant inside a resealable ziplock bag, and the cardboard reel is eco-friendly but requires a Polymaker roller wrap for machines with AMS systems — the cardboard can bind in some enclosures. Several experienced users note that flow rates need adjustment: calibrating esteps or cranking extrusion to 120% eliminates the under-extrusion that first-time TPU users often blame on the filament itself.
Print speeds between 20-40 mm/s at 210-230°C produce the best surface quality. Retraction should stay below 0.1 mm at 15 mm/s to avoid jamming in the hotend. The material prints cleaner than most TPU rivals, with fewer strings and blobs when settings are dialed. For someone who wants the highest reliability and surface finish from a flexible spool, PolyFlex justifies its premium price.
What works
- Exceptional layer adhesion and surface finish
- 400% strain-to-failure for durable flexible parts
- Prints reliably on open-frame machines without hardware mods
What doesn’t
- Cardboard spool does not fit AMS without adapter
- Requires flow calibration for consistent extrusion
3. Creality 2 kg Black & White ABS Filament 1.75mm Bundle
Creality’s CR-ABS offers two full kilograms of filament in black and white, making it the most economical route for high-volume ABS printing. The material is noticeably impact-resistant and holds up to vibration and strain better than average ABS blends — several users printed tool head covers and fan ducts that survived repeated heating cycles without cracking. The recommended nozzle temperature of 230°C works well, though a few prints needed 300°C peaks for high-temp enclosures.
Diameter consistency across the bundle is good, with no reports of clogs or stringing during normal use. The spools are well-wound with no tangles, and extrusion is smooth from start to finish. The key trade-off is warp management: this is a standard ABS blend, not a low-warp variant, so an enclosed printer with a chamber temperature above 45°C is non-negotiable for large flat surfaces. Some users noted a strong chemical smell despite the “non-toxic” claim, so active ventilation is still required.
A minor color variation between the black and white rolls is visible in large single-color prints, but for functional parts where cosmetics are secondary, this is irrelevant. If you have a stable enclosure and need ABS in bulk for engineering prototypes or structural brackets, this bundle delivers the most material per dollar without sacrificing print quality.
What works
- Excellent impact resistance for functional parts
- Generous 2 kg bundle at a competitive price
- Consistent extrusion with no clogging or stringing
What doesn’t
- Requires enclosed printer to manage warp on large prints
- Strong chemical smell despite non-toxic labeling
4. ANYCUBIC TPU Filament 1.75mm 95A Soft Flexible 1kg
ANYCUBIC’s TPU 95A is a straightforward, no-surprises flexible filament that prints cleanly on machines with direct-drive extruders. Users report zero stringing at recommended temperatures (195-230°C) with good bed adhesion on a 50-60°C heated bed. The rubber-like texture is slightly firmer than some competing 95A blends, which actually helps with dimensional accuracy in thin-walled parts like gaskets and bellows.
The 1 kg spool is well-sealed against moisture, but like all TPU, it must be stored in a dry environment between prints. A handful of users experienced clogs on Bowden-type printers — this is a limitation of the extruder geometry, not the filament itself. On direct-drive machines, extrusion is smooth and the finish is matte with minimal layer lines. The material is tough enough for outdoor use, with good wear and oil resistance reported by users printing car headlight housings and protective gear.
For a first-time TPU buyer, this spool offers the lowest barrier to entry without sacrificing print quality. The pre-configured profile in ANYCUBIC’s slicer works well, but you can also dial it into Bambu Studio, Cura, or PrusaSlicer with minimal tweaking. If you want a single color, large spool of flexible filament that behaves predictably, start here.
What works
- Zero stringing and smooth extrusion out of the package
- Good wear and oil resistance for outdoor prints
- Beginner-friendly with pre-configured slicer settings
What doesn’t
- prone to clogging on Bowden-type extruders
- Needs aggressive drying if spool has been open for a few days
5. JAYO TPU 3D Printer Filament 4-Color Bundle, 1kg Total
JAYO’s four-color bundle solves a specific problem: you need multiple colors of TPU without committing to four full kilogram spools. Each 250 g mini-spool (green, orange, red, blue) delivers enough material for a handful of small functional prints like custom gaskets, keyring cases, or watch bands. The Shore 95A formulation is slightly softer than the Polymaker equivalent, which makes it easier to achieve watertight seals on bellows and grommets.
The small spools do not fit standard printer posts without printed adapters — the center hole is narrower than typical, and the plastic spool clips are flimsy. Several users reported that the filament itself prints well after a proper drying cycle (24 hours in a filament dryer at 50°C eliminated the stringing and popping that comes from absorbed moisture). The diameter tolerance of +/- 0.03 mm is adequate for most printers, though the edges of the spool are not perfectly round, which can cause binding on spool holders with narrow rollers.
This bundle is ideal for makers who want to prototype flexible parts in multiple colors or who need small quantities of TPU for infill projects. The per-gram cost is reasonable for a multi-color bundle, and the print quality once dialed competes with premium single-color spools. Just plan on building or printing adapters to fit the spools to your machine.
What works
- Four distinct colors in one purchase for multi-color projects
- Good flexibility and durability after correct drying
- Cost-effective way to test TPU without buying large spools
What doesn’t
- Small spools do not fit standard printer posts without adapters
- Requires thorough drying before first use
Hardware & Specs Guide
ABS Pro vs. Standard ABS
Standard ABS shrinks roughly 0.5-0.8% during cooling, which causes corners to lift on prints larger than a palm. ABS Pro formulations reduce this shrink rate by modifying the polymer chain structure, cutting warp by roughly 40% and lowering the VOC emission profile. The trade-off is a slight reduction in impact strength — ABS Pro is less ductile than classic ABS when cold, but for most functional parts the stiffness is preferred over brittleness.
TPU Shore Hardness and Print Speed
Shore 95A is the most printed TPU hardness because it balances flexibility with extrusion stability. Softer TPU (85A or lower) is extremely stretchy but prints poorly on Bowden extruders and requires speeds below 20 mm/s. Firmer TPU (98A) behaves more like nylon but loses the rubbery feel. At Shore 95A, you can print at 30-60 mm/s on a direct-drive machine and still get good interlayer bonding. Slowing to 20 mm/s improves surface quality noticeably on overhangs and bridges.
FAQ
Can I print ABS in an open-frame printer without an enclosure?
Should I dry TPU filament before printing even if it is vacuum sealed?
Why does my TPU print keep jamming in the extruder?
Can I use ABS filament for parts that sit in a hot car in summer?
Final Thoughts: The Verdict
For most users, the 3d printer filament winner is the FLASHFORGE ABS Pro because its low-warp formulation prints reliably on enclosed machines and produces rigid, heat-resistant parts without the aggressive odor of standard ABS. If you need flexible prints with top-tier surface finish and durability, grab the Polymaker PolyFlex TPU95. And for budget-conscious high-volume ABS work, nothing beats the Creality CR-ABS 2 kg bundle.





